ArchtopK said:"northshore, and ThrustVector's BetterDry are some of the best non-abdl all-white available." I second this. Northshore, has a more solid fit over time, but does that with a firmer, denser pad. They won't hold as much, but stay in place. BetterDry, like all high SAP diapers is softer when dry, but will expand in the crotch significantly. So I like them when I am staying in at home, but like the Northshores when going out and about.
trouble63 said:I've used the north shore supreme, the Abena m4 and the confi dry 24/7. They're all good, but bulky and they crinkle. I liked the Abena the best so far. I think it's the smaller of the 3.
With so few choices for a thinner plastic backed diaper, I decided to give the cloth backed a try since I usually wear plastic pants anyway. I have tried the Tena Stretch super and Stretch Ultra. I like them both. Absorbent enough for 4 hours, quiet and fairly thin. The Ultra is a little thinner, but in my experience is just as absorbent. The best part of all is the Velcro like tabs. Much easier than raw and more adjustable.
